BENGALURU: Webhosting a 3-day World Tutorial Conference to commemorate 60 years of Pandit Deendayal Upadhyaya’s historical lectures on Ekatma Manav Darshan at his campus proved to be costly for Karnataka Narrate Open University (KSOU) based mostly in Mysuru city after Narrate Govt ordered freezing of accounts of the Open University citing financial irregularities.

Nevertheless, the Narrate Govt in its inform on Tuesday mentioned “It has on the subject of the seek of the Narrate Govt that prima facie financial irregularities salvage been noticed in Karnataka Narrate Open University (KSOU), Mysuru and the subject is under inquiry.”

The inform added in inform to safeguard public funds and be sure that integrity of the inquiry, the Secretary to Govt, Higher Education Department has been requested to freeze (debit freeze) all financial institution accounts of the University including linked accounts unless extra orders.

Meanwhile, the convention started on Wednesday which is organized by Prajna Pravah and Dr Syama Prasad Mookerjee Examine Foundation. Sources mentioned both the organisers of the convention on KSOU campus are affiliated to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h (RSS) and there changed into a transparent course from the Narrate Govt to the Open University no longer to enable the convention.

Sources mentioned a seek on Vice-Chancellor of KSOU Dr Sharanappa Halase changed into served by the Narrate Govt asking an evidence over the school web web hosting the convention on its campus against the inform of the Narrate Govt. Nevertheless, the explanation from the Vice-Chancellor did no longer satisfy the Narrate Govt which ordered the freezing of accounts.

Talking to Deccan Myth, KSOU Vice-Chancellor Dr Sharanappa Halase mentioned he would seek the advice of ethical experts on initiating future course action against the Narrate Govt’s inform to freeze varsity’s financial institution accounts. The ethical experts will likely be consulted on Thursday.

The KSOU Vice-Chancellor attributed the action of the Narrate Govt to freeze its financial institution accounts ‘a repercussion over convention hosted at its campus.’ Halase puzzled the reason of the Narrate Govt over its inform to freeze financial institution accounts of KSOU and mentioned “Show has been issued without following procedures.”

The Vice-Chancellor claimed the convention on its campus is academic and nothing to attain with politics and mentioned “It’s miles a philosophical programme.”
